Transaction debfb0ab28c2346b73ffee6609e7be74b74d2734ba3b82a16e6caad576b9174e
1 Input
1 Output
-
debfb0ab28c2346b73ffee6609e7be74b74d2734ba3b82a16e6caad576b9174e:0
- value
- 3495883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9be188bf132fca64cde65e09bbbb7a11ecb52f3 OP_EQUAL
- address
- 3HAXr4FCdsaafFCs2JoG238HxBunpMRDKJ